The Dorset Heaths lie to the south of the Dorset Downs and extend south of Poole Harbour to the prominent chalk ridge of the Isle of Purbeck. To the east, the boundary with the New Forest is formed by the Avon Valley. Of the Character Area, 22% is urban and around 20% lies within the Dorset AONB. Protective designations cover 95% of the remaining heathland. A significant number of heaths are also designated as National Nature Reserves.
